About the car:
I feel like Jaguar treats E-Pace as a worse child. I saw new Interactive Dash Display in MY19 F-Pace, and it looks same as in E-Pace, but E-Pace one is much much less configurable and useful. Jaguar IDD is the only system, which is totally useless and there's no difference between manual one. There is no more options! Just digital gauges....
I have manual transmission, and some messages wanting me to put my gear at P...
There is a few apps less in Live, don't know why, and event more, there is no TuneIn and Deezer... why is that ? Deezer is a web app for music.... why I can't listen with that software in Poland?
Some options in remote are disabled....
Dealer promised me, that rear lights will be animated, they aren't....
Car is turning right itself, and driver doors don't fit properly. Looks like I need to take the car to dealer to fix it.
The only thing I really miss, is the map at the middle in IDD, there is only full map mode, which is useless for me, as there is no engine rev informations, so I don't know exactly when to change gear!
For now I feel really disappointed, and if not that I always wanted a Jaguar, I would regret my purchase.
